Understanding the Modern Fishing Game Landscape
Traditional fishing video games once occupied a niche segment, often characterised by cartoonish graphics and straightforward mechanics. However, contemporary titles are embracing high-fidelity graphics, detailed environmental modelling, and mechanics that mimic real-world fishing scenarios. These advances serve a dual purpose:
- Attracting a broader demographic: By offering realistic experiences, games appeal not only to casual players but also to fishing enthusiasts and industry experts.
- Enhancing player engagement: Authentic mechanics foster emotional investment, making the virtual fishing experience more meaningful.

Technical Elements Driving Immersive Experiences
Key technological advancements underpinning these sophisticated games include:
| Feature | Description | Impact on Gameplay |
|---|---|---|
| Realistic Physics Engine | Simulates water currents, fish movement, and gear interaction with high accuracy. | Allows players to develop genuine strategies akin to real fishing, increasing skill transferability. |
| Dynamic Ecosystem Modelling | Creates changing habitats, fish populations, and weather conditions. | Offers varied challenge levels, enhancing replayability and educational value. |
| Customisable Equipment | Extensive options for rods, reels, baits, and apparel based on real brands and specifications. | Enables realistic testing and learning of gear selection for specific fishing scenarios. |
| Augmented Reality (AR) Integration | Some titles incorporate AR to blend virtual and real environments. | Provides immersive experience and potential for real-world skill improvement. |

Industry Trends and Future Directions
The trajectory of fishing simulation gaming suggests further innovation, with developments such as:
- VR and AR Integration: Enhancing realism through immersive technologies.
- Community-Driven Content: User-generated ecosystems, virtual tournaments, and sharing via online platforms.
- AI-Powered Fish Behaviour: Smarter fish that react dynamically based on environmental factors and player actions.
These developments promise to deepen engagement and broaden the educational reach of such titles, cementing their place as vital tools for both entertainment and knowledge dissemination.
